How To Use Shopify Themes to Create Online Stores

Starting an online store is a great way to expand the market for your current physical store or simply launch a business without the high cost of a brick and mortar store. What’s more, it’s not as hard as it once was. Rather than hiring a developer to program a custom platform for you, you can choose from dozens of available e-commerce platforms and get your store up and running in a matter of hours.

What Does Shopify Offer?

Some of the main features that Shopify offers include:

  1. can accept payments face-to-face using the Shopify POS
  2. sell your products using Facebook Messenger, Facebook, Pinterest, Amazon, eBay, and other platforms
  3. sync between your physical and your online store
  4. calculate taxes with automatic tax rate calculator based on your location
  5. can offer free shipping
  6. compatible with numerous third-party apps for accounting, shipping, growing your email list, adding product reviews, and more

Shopify Themes

A great feature of Shopify is the sheer number of Shopify themes that are available. Third-party marketplaces like Envato Elements have plenty of Shopify themes to choose from and they are suitable for a variety of niches. They’re also easy to customize and most of them even allow you to import demo content with a single click so all you’ve got to do is replace it with your own content, rather than adding that section from scratch.
